Indians Are Slamming Modi’s War Memorial Speech, They’re Calling It ‘Cheap Personal Politics’

On Monday, Prime Minister Narendra Modi inaugurated the National War Memorial in New Delhi, where his speech touched upon some crucial points like the Rafale deal or even Rahul Gandhi.

However, while some lauded the move of unravelling India’s very first war memorial, a lot of people are saying that this is nothing but a cheap publicity stunt.

In fact, a lot of war veterans have resorted to social media to express their discontent. According to them, Modi’s speech was highly politicized and that he had ulterior motives behind the inauguration.

According to Indians online, Modi was using the war memorial as a means of winning people over, and in order to secure votes in the upcoming elections.

A lot of people are saying that this is a new low, as far as Modi is concerned. This is all the more so since the country continues to mourn the 44 soldiers who were martyred in Pulwama on 14th February.

In such vulnerable times, Modi should have been slightly more sensitive while making his speech. A little bit of subtlety and sensitivity never hurt anyone.
